    Have a buddy who just installed a spinner on his Acert ( feed is from 1/4 pipe plug behind oil filter) hes running schaeffers 7000 .his plan is to change Cat oil filter every 25k and sample til something in UOA spikes then change oil. theory is that at 17.00/gal even if you get only 50-60k on oil he believes he will be farther ahead because the spinner removes the soot and alot of the metals. i really like this theory. wish i had gone this route. like Pullingtrucker said,"no filters to change"
